sausage rolls
puff pastry pork sausage rolls freshly baked. they don't look great, my first attempt, but tasted ok. i've eaten six the rest have been boxed for the freezer
ready made puff pastry (£1.15) www.sainsburys.co.uk/gol-ui/product/sainsburys-sheet-puff... (first time i've used it and would definitely buy again)
400 grammes minced pork £5 (300grammes would have been ok)
finely chopped onion
panko breadcrumbs (leftover from the sushi)
herbs
2 tablespoons of water
1 egg
salt & pepper
sesame seeds
mixed the minced pork with onion, breadcrumbs, herbs, water, salt and pepper
halved the mixed sausage meat
cut the length of pastry in half
laid half the mixed sausage meat along one half of the pastry
brushed the edges with whisked egg and sealed
did the same with the other half and sealed
cut into smaller sausage rolls
brushed the tops with whisked egg
placed in a preheated oven at 220 fah
the recipe said 30 to 35 mins but i left it in for more like 45/50 mins to make sure the meat was properly cooked
i burnt the base of the rolls as i had the tray of rolls too close to the lower elements of the mini countertop oven.
when i realised i moved the tray up a shelf and all was fine
the mini countertop oven for baking uses
only the bottom elements, not the top elements
a shelf at least up one from the bottom to prevent burning
